UPDATE: The Riverdale Avenue Community School (RACS) and Riverdale Avenue Middle School (RAMS) have officially opened a state-of-the-art auditorium in Brownsville, NY, on December 12, 2023. This new facility marks a significant investment in the educational and creative future of the historic campus, which has served the community for over 100 years.

The ribbon-cutting ceremony brought together students, families, educators, and community partners, creating an atmosphere of celebration and hope. New York State Senator Roxanne J. Persaud, who secured vital funding for the project, was present to inaugurate the space officially. Also attending was Assemblywoman Latrice Walker, representing Assembly District 55, who participated in a special performance, emphasizing the auditorium’s importance as a hub for arts and community connection.

Principal Arabelle Pembroke expressed the significance of the new facility, stating, “Fresh, new and up-to-date spaces in school are important because they send a message to students that they are cared for and valued.” This sentiment resonates deeply within a community where access to quality educational resources is crucial.

The auditorium will serve as a central venue for student performances, arts programs, family gatherings, and community events, addressing a long-standing need on campus. School leaders highlight that this expansion significantly enhances opportunities for student engagement and creative expression.

Founded in 1908, Partnership with Children works tirelessly to strengthen the emotional, social, and cognitive skills of over 20,000 children and families across 40 New York City public schools. By embedding licensed clinical social workers and teaching artists within schools, they provide trauma-informed mental health counseling and community-based programming, ensuring that the needs of students are met holistically.

The addition of the new auditorium broadens the scope of arts education and community-centered programming in Brownsville, creating a shared space where students, families, and the broader community can gather, celebrate, and connect. As RACS and RAMS continue to serve as anchors in the Brownsville community, this development is poised to significantly impact school culture and community engagement.
